Best Seam Ripper Buying Guide

Every keen sewer will need a quality seam ripper in their sewing arsenal. But with so many different types and styles of seam rippers available on the market, it can be tempting to just choose the first one that you stumble across.

But is that seam ripper the ideal tool for your needs?

There are a couple of things you should look for before you commit to buying your new seam ripper.

Most of the seam rippers available on the market are fairly inexpensive, so you should ensure that they have all the features you’ll need to make good use of them rather than opt for one that’s cheap and cheerful.

Take a look at these factors below before buying your new seam ripper!

Sharp

One of the most important factors to consider will be how sharp your chosen seam ripper is. There’s little point investing in a blunt or soon to be dull seam ripper, as you’ll only have to buy another one to replace it.

As long as the blade of the seam ripper is sharp enough to cut away at any unwanted threads, you should be able to power through your sewing projects.

If your seam ripper’s blade is sharp, you should be able to use it to cut a variety of materials, including thread, fabric, and even perhaps fishing wire should you need to.

Easy grip

You don’t want to buy a seam ripper that’s hard for you to use. As long as your chosen seam ripper has been designed to be easy to grip, you can rest assured that it will let you get the job done.

The majority of seam rippers should come with a flat, easy to grip handle, but some are designed with ergonomic handles so as to be even easier for those who struggle to hold the smaller seam rippers.

It’s worth bearing in mind that there are generally two different sizes of seam ripper. The larger seam rippers - which tend to be between 5 to 5.5 inches in length - will be easier to grip for those who may be suffering from arthritis.

The smaller seam rippers can also use their safety caps as an extension of the handle while you use it.

Safety cap

Seam rippers will need to be sharp in order to be effective. So it’s only sensible to opt for a seam ripper that will come with a safety cap, to ensure that you don’t accidentally hurt yourself when looking for it in your sewing kit!

The great thing about a safety cap is that it serves two purposes. Not only will it protect you from hurting yourself, but it will also protect your seam ripper’s blade from becoming damaged when it’s not in use.

This will be crucial for ensuring that the blade stays sharp and able to be used at a moment’s notice.

Different sizes

It’s worth bearing in mind that seam rippers are available in a variety of different sizes - small and large.

Depending on how much money you want to spend, it may be unnecessary to have to choose between the two, as they come available in packs which include both.

Smaller seam rippers will be great for getting to those finer stitches, or stitches that are a little harder to reach. These can often use their safety cap as an extension of the handle to make them easier for you to hold, too.

Larger seam rippers will be easier to grip thanks to their longer handle. These versatile seam rippers will be able to do the bulk of the work you need them for, but it may be nice to have a choice between the two sizes just in case.

Durable

You’ll want to ensure that the seam ripper you pick is durable enough to cope with all of your sewing projects. A less durable seam ripper will only break when it’s been used several times, and will need to be replaced quicker.

Take a look at the materials that have been used to construct the seam ripper. What is the handle made of? The safety cap made of? What metal has been used to create the blade?

Stainless steel is a good thing to look for, as this is specifically designed against rusting and corrosion.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the red ball on a seam ripper for?

The red ball is to help you from ripping your fabric when you rip away at seams.

Once you’ve used the longer part of the blade to start cutting away at a seam, you can save yourself time with the rest of the stitches by putting the red ball face down under the stitch.

When you move your seam ripper along the threads you wish to cut, this allows you to do it much quicker than by trying to cut each individual stitch.

Can you sharpen a seam ripper?

You can indeed sharpen a seam ripper!

You can do this either by using steel wool or by using a bead reamer.
